New York Man Killed In Freak Accident at Town Trash Transfer Station

-

On Monday, a 47 year-old man died from being trapped between a loading box and a trash compactor at a town trash transfer station in the Adirondacks. According toSyracuse local news.

According to the outlet, state police arrived at Long Lake Transfer Station early in the morning on Aug. 9. This station handles the collection and disposal waste materials. 

An investigation into the man’s death revealed that a container rolled into the trash compactor due to a cable snapping, according to Syracuse local news.

According to the outlet, the man was standing near the incident and was pinched between them, killing him.
